Output 3dff98c60b749beecbc5f2922b73f2644cf5bc1d75be3b9846e6c3bb49f3ba40:3

value
8580443
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 622c7f9684aa0b611bcd9c861d2d9e5171ce013d OP_EQUALVERIFY OP_CHECKSIG
address
19x6XbuJVKeD3YUD2P73q55NKwAEsDdYXv
transaction
3dff98c60b749beecbc5f2922b73f2644cf5bc1d75be3b9846e6c3bb49f3ba40
spent
true